自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

原创 R语言与数据分析

当今计算机系统要处理的数据类型变得多种多样,并且为了深入理解,需要对数据进行过滤;同时,开源应用变得越来广受欢迎,这一切都在改变着 R 这一用于统计分析与可视化的语言。随着时代的发展,R语言也在不断的衍变,并成为了当前很多大数据应用当中的一个环节。 大数据时代,R 语言已蓄势待发,各位学员,let's go!视频地址:http://edu.csdn.net/course/detail/...

2015-05-15 20:58:14 142

原创 matlab-矩阵合并

a =     1     2     3     2     3     4b =     4     5     6     5     9     9要求:c =     1     2     3     2     3     4     4     5     6     5     9     9使用命令:c = [a; b]同时要横向合并,如产生c =     1     2   ...

2013-06-10 13:56:34 522

原创 c++科学计算库

http://www-900.ibm.com/developerWorks/cn/linux/other/matrix/index.shtml评估和比较 Meschach、Cooperware 矩阵和 Blitz,developworks上的文章,进行了分析比较,尤其是性能分析,没有提到mtl,http://blog.csdn.net/ccboy/archive/2003/05/02/1...

2013-06-05 21:58:06 175

原创 PostgreSQL学习手册(常用数据类型)

一、数值类型:    下面是PostgreSQL所支持的数值类型的列表和简单说明:名字存储空间描述范围smallint2 字节小范围整数-32768 到 +32767integer4 字节常用的整数-2147483648 到 +2147483647bigint8 字节大范围的整数-922337203685477580...

2013-06-03 16:45:57 126

翻译 wxwidgets-学习心得(2)

#include <wx/wx.h>#include <ctime>using namespace std;// 应用程序类class wxMyApp : public wxApp{public: // 虚函数 virtual bool OnInit();};//窗口类class wxMyFrame:public w...

2013-05-14 22:17:32 136

翻译 wxwidgets学习心得(1)

#include <wx/wx.h>// application classclass wxMyApp : public wxApp{public: // 虚函数 virtual bool OnInit(); // 处理按钮事件 void OnClick(wxCommandEvent& event) { ...

2013-05-13 12:01:00 67

原创 R-并行计算

啊。。。找了一下,R 居然真的有办法可以多cpu平行运算!!!snowfall包!先在这里寄存一下。明天实验。太棒了!转贴自:不周山R本身虽然只能以单线程的方式运行与计算,但它有大量的包提供了方便而多样的并行计算方式,支持包括SOCKET、MPI、PVM、NWS等等多种 线程沟通方式。最流行最成熟的当然是MPI了,Rmpi包也因此相当受欢迎,在它的基础上可以实现各种MPI支持的并行编程范式。...

2013-04-28 10:50:43 82

翻译 gtk+学习笔记-2

对gtk+初始化的检查gtk_init_check(&argc,&argv)返回true或false#include <stdlib.h>#include <gtk/gtk.h>int main(int argc,char *argv[]){ GtkWidget *mywindow; //初始化gtk+...

2013-04-11 11:16:22 50

翻译 gtk+学习笔记-1

#include <stdlib.h>#include <gtk/gtk.h>int main(int argc,char *argv[]){ GtkWidget *mywindow; //初始化gtk+和支持库 gtk_init(&argc,&argv); //创建新的窗口,并设置相关参数...

2013-04-11 10:50:35 46

原创 谱聚类

1. 谱聚类      给你博客园上若干个博客,让你将它们分成K类,你会怎样做?想必有很多方法,本文要介绍的是其中的一种——谱聚类。      聚类的直观解释是根据样本间相似度,将它们分成不同组。谱聚类的思想是将样本看作顶点,样本间的相似度看作带权的边,从而将聚类问题转为图分割问题:找到一种图分割的方法使得连接不同组的边的权重尽可能低(这意味着组间相似度要尽可能低),组内的边的权重尽可能高(...

2013-04-11 10:44:25 58

原创 对变化建模-用差分方程-动力系统及常数解

差分表示在一个时间周期里考察对象的变化量。 差分表示在一个时间周期里考察对象的变化量。     

2013-04-09 15:24:08 102

原创 逻辑斯蒂映射-伪随机数

  逻辑斯蒂映射的形式为x_(n+1)=ax_n(1-x_n),其中a是参数,当a>=3.569946时,x的值不再振荡,进入混沌,在此之前,x的值处于稳定状态,a值较小时,稳定在某个固定值,较大时,稳定在某个周期内  因此,利用a>=3.569946时,可以产生伪随机数,因为此时x值不稳定,无法预测。具体原理如下 :      此外, 逻辑斯蒂(l...

2013-04-04 15:28:21 343

原创 pb串口编程

powerbuilder串口编程的实现因公司软件产品需要和POS机进行通信,所以笔者研究了一下PB串口编程的实现方式。 PB是一个非常好的数据库管理系统的开发工具,但在web和计算机接口通信等方面PB就不是很好用了。幸好我们有ole和com这些很牛的技术,可以让我们非常容易的使用一些组件的功能,而不用自己去开发去关心底层的业务逻辑。使用PB进行串口编程有两种途径,一种是使用微软提...

2013-03-21 16:08:47 98

原创 matlab-多项式乘除法及式子和导数

>> a=[22  12 4  54] a =     22    12     4    54 >> b=[-1 23 30] b =     -1    23    30 乘法>> conv(a,b) ans =          -22         494         932  ...

2013-03-21 15:06:49 758

原创 matlab-数组-元胞数据与结构数组

y、z是元胞数组,num2cell完成由数值数组到元胞数组的转换>> x=[12 33 22;55 22 44] x =     12    33    22    55    22    44 >> y=num2cell(x) y =      [12]    [33]    [22]    [55]    [22] ...

2013-03-20 17:45:47 163

原创 矩阵-范数

>> aa =    12    33   444    22    33   111    22   333   135>> norm(a)ans =  506.3861>> norm(a,1)ans =   690>> norm(a,inf)ans =   490>>一般来讲矩阵范...

2013-03-13 17:30:32 64

原创 向量-范数

>> b=a(3,:)b =    22   333   135>> norm(b,1)ans =  490.0000>> norm(b,2)ans =  359.9972>> norm(b,inf)ans =   333>> 设V(F)是数域发F上的线性空间,定义在F上的实值函数...

2013-03-13 16:06:02 74

原创 矩阵-求逆

设R是一个交换环,A是一个以R中元素为系数的 n×n 的矩阵。A的伴随矩阵可按如下步骤定义:定义:A关于第i 行第j 列的余子式(记作Mij)是去掉A的第i行第j列之后得到的(n − 1)×(n − 1)矩阵的行列式。定义:A关于第i 行第j 列的代数余子式是:。定义:A的余子矩阵是一个n×n的矩阵C,使得其第i 行第j 列的元素是A关于第i 行第j 列的代数余子式。...

2013-02-27 15:51:25 76

原创 lisp-关联列表

* (defparameter *xxx* '((liu . 123)(wang 121)))*XXX** *xxx*((LIU . 123) (WANG 121))* *xxx*((LIU . 123) (WANG 121))* (assoc 'liu *xxx*)(LIU . 123)* (assoc 'wang *xxx*)(WANG...

2013-02-24 20:14:20 165

原创 Firebug-firefox下的编辑JS的利器

Firebug是一个Firefox插件,集HTML查看和编辑、Javascript控制台、网络状况监视器于一体,是开发 JavaScript、CSS、HTML和Ajax的得力助手。更是我们这些ExtJs开发人员必备的一个工具.用它来监视 ExtJs的 post,get值非常方便.安装及使用方法: 1,直接用Firefox打开以下地址:https://addons.mozilla.org/zh...

2013-02-10 18:54:43 114

原创 15 个顶级 HTML5 游戏引擎

1) HTML5 Game EngineConstruct 2 is a leading high quality HTML5 game engine. Tens of thousands of HTML5 game developers are choosing Construct 2 to make HTML5 games.2) Clanfxclanfx is a 2D...

2013-02-10 12:30:16 194

原创 lisp-基本输入,输出,read,print

* (say-hello)ssssssss"what's your name?" "hello" SSSSSSSS SSSSSSSS(defun say-hello() (print "what's your name?") (let ((name (read))) (print "hello") (print name) ))  * (progn...

2013-02-09 22:51:24 386

翻译 lisp-push

* (defvar *mylist* (list 11 22 33))*MYLIST** (push `222 *mylist*)(222 11 22 33)*

2013-02-09 20:41:14 51

翻译 lisp-find

* (find `wang `((wang 22)(li 26)) )NIL* (find `li `(li ss ))LI*  find为查找,可以在后面加上:key后跟函数,这函数将对要查找的对象进一步操作后查找* (find `wang `((wang 22)(li 26)) :key #'car)(WANG 22)...

2013-02-09 14:08:51 85

原创 lisp-交换列表中2个元素

* (defvar *mylist* (list 1 2 3 4))*MYLIST** (rotatef (nth 1 *mylist*) (nth 2 *mylist*))NIL* *mylist*(1 3 2 4) * (defvar *mylist* `(223 44 99 -88))*MYLIST** (rotatef (nth ...

2013-02-08 20:10:54 171

翻译 lisp-求最大和最小数,if的使用

* (defun maxnum(x y) (if (> x y) x y))STYLE-WARNING: redefining COMMON-LISP-USER::MAXNUM in DEFUNMAXNUM* (maxnum 9 8)9* (maxnum 8 9)9* (maxnum 112 990)990 使用了progn,p...

2013-02-08 17:04:32 225

原创 lisp-关于mapcar、apply、assoc 列表操作

0[2] (mapcar #'+ `(22 11 55) `(111 222 333))(133 233 388)0[2] (mapcar #'cdr `((22 11 55) (111 222 333)))((11 55) (222 333))0[2] (apply #'append `((22 11 55) (111 222 333)))(22 11 55 ...

2013-02-08 12:53:43 884

原创 perl-lwp笔记

2008-01-07 10:25perl的LWP模块介绍一 LWP::Simple 功能1. 如何在Perl中使用该模块?use LWP::Simple;2. 如何获取一个页面内容?my $content = get(’http://www.yahoo.com.cn’);get函数把从www.yahoo.com.cn上获取得页面内容全部赋给$content这个变量...

2013-02-05 19:51:17 95

原创 lisp-progn

* (if (oddp 5) (progn (setf *xx* t) `ok) `allright) OK* (setf *xx* nil) NIL* *xx* NIL* (if (oddp 6) (progn (setf *xx* t) `ok) `allright) ALLRIGHT* *xx* NIL* progn的目...

2013-02-05 09:43:35 153

翻译 lisp-列表

This is experimental prerelease support for the Windows platform: useat your own risk.  "Your Kitten of Death awaits!"0] (list 5 6 10)(5 6 10)0]* (let ((x 15) (y 10) (xt 30) (yt 90)) (cons (+ ...

2013-02-01 21:33:03 57

翻译 perl-opengl几何变换函数

#!/usr/bin/perl -wuse strict;use warnings;use OpenGL qw/ :all /;use OpenGL::Config; glutInit();glutInitDisplayMode(GLUT_RGB|GLUT_SINGLE);glutInitWindowPosition(100,100);glutInitWi...

2013-02-01 10:48:51 42

原创 perl-opengl基本图形操作-缩放,二维旋转,二维平移

#!/usr/bin/perl -wuse strict;use warnings;use OpenGL qw/ :all /;use OpenGL::Config; glutInit();glutInitDisplayMode(GLUT_RGB|GLUT_SINGLE);glutInitWindowPosition(100,100);glutInitWi...

2013-02-01 09:08:03 210

原创 prezi-中文输入

首先,先下载中文字体,用的是Pez_GBC_Fonts中文补丁。地址是http://pan.baidu.com/share/link?shareid=1822&uk=170326629  第二步,解压打开,选择你喜欢的字体。比如以这三个字体为例 FZSTK (方正舒体)msyh (微软雅黑)simhei (黑体) 打开Prezi Desktop按下Ctrl+Shift+c,出现Edi...

2013-01-31 15:33:41 196

原创 lisp-复数

* (+ #C(28 10) 22)#C(50 10)* (+ #C(28 10) #C(22 16))#C(50 26)* (+ #c(28 10) #c(22 16))#C(50 26)* (let ((a #c(28 10)) (b #c(22 16))) (* a b))#C(456 668) #C(28 10)28是实部,10是虚...

2013-01-30 22:23:35 55

翻译 lisp-局部变量和局部函数

* (flet ((add (a b) (+ a b))) (add 3 7))10* (let ((ja 5) (jb 1)) (* ja jb))5* (flet ((add (a b) (+ a b)) (sub (a b) (- a b))) (sub 12 (add 3 7)))2 let定义局部变量 flet定义局部函数...

2013-01-30 22:07:04 285

原创 lisp强大

以前就听说过Lisp被很多人认为是世界上最好的语言 ,但是它是那么的古老,这种言论很可能来自于不能进化到学习Ruby,Python的老古董,所以其实也没有太在意。Lisp(这里特指Common lisp,下同)1978年被设计完成,是个多么古老的语言啊。。。。却总是不停的听到太多的Lisp的好话,总是感觉有些难以相信,BS说,"一个新设计的语言不比老的好,那新语言的设计者是要被打屁股的 ",假如...

2013-01-30 21:02:11 221

翻译 lisp-猜数字升级版

0[2] (defun mystart() (defparameter *small* 1)(defparameter *big* 100)(guess-number))0[3] (mystart); No debug variables for current frame: using EVAL instead of EVAL-IN-FRAME.500[3] (bigger)...

2013-01-30 18:03:41 55

翻译 lisp-猜数字算法与全局函数、变量

* (defvar *big* 100)*BIG** (defvar *small* 1)*SMALL* 500] (defun smaller() (setf *big* (1- (guess-number)))(guess-number))SMALLER0] (defun bigger() (setf *small* (1+ (guess-n...

2013-01-30 17:55:14 62

原创 prezi desktop

prezi试用版的破解方法 (2012-05-02 21:11:08) 1.从网上找个prezi试用版,下载后安装即可,但只有30天的试用期。 2.破解的方法主要是突破试用期的限制。 3.下载一个cracklock小软件,可从网上免费下载。 4.下载后安装cracklock,由开始菜单打开cracklock manager,见下图。 5. 打开后左键双击add programe,从pre...

2013-01-29 22:36:35 88

翻译 perl-opengl-glutMotionFunc鼠标事件

#!/usr/bin/perl -wuse strict;use warnings;use OpenGL qw/ :all /;use OpenGL::Config; #!/usr/bin/perl -wuse strict;use warnings;use OpenGL qw/ :all /;use OpenGL::Config; ...

2013-01-25 15:54:14 84

提示
确定要删除当前文章?
取消 删除